Lincoln Nova Vital Recovery is an addiction treatment program for individuals living in Hodge and within the surrounding neighborhoods and struggling with an alcohol and drug abuse issue and co-occurring mental health disorder. It provides services like activity therapy, rational emotive behavioral therapy, group therapy, dialectical behavior therapy, relapse prevention, vocational rehabilitation services and more, that are in keeping with its philosophy of evidence based treatments that are proven effective.
Lincoln Nova Vital Recovery believes in individual treatment to ensure that their clients find success and sobriety. The drug and alcohol rehab center has also specialized in other treatments like suicide prevention services, co-occurring mental and substance abuse disorders, persons with post-traumatic stress disorder, self-help groups, residential beds for client's children, clients with HIV/AIDS - among many others. Many of these services are also offered by Lincoln Nova Vital Recovery in different settings like outpatient detoxification centers, inpatient drug treatment, short term rehab programs, outpatient substance abuse counseling, long term treatment facilities, as well as others.
Further, it has aftercare programs and other treatment methods created to help you find permanent and lasting stability. These services have made sure that Lincoln Nova Vital Recovery has a special place within Hodge, LA. and its surrounding area, especially because they promote positive long term outcomes for the clients who enroll into this drug and alcohol rehab facility. Lastly, Lincoln Nova Vital Recovery accepts private insurance, private pay, medicare, medicaid, military insurance, state corrections or juvenile justice funds, county or local government funds and others.
